Tiredness

The feeling of fatigue is constant of fatigue or fatigued feeling that makes it difficult to carry out daily activities. Fatigue can be a sign of a more serious health issue or caused by lifestyle factors such as poor nutrition or insufficient exercise. It can also be a result of excessive alcohol consumption.

It could be a sign that you have mental health problems, such as depression and anxiety. If you're experiencing fatigue and feel it is impacting your daily routine it is an ideal idea to consult a doctor for an assessment.

Fatigue can be caused by a variety of factors including lifestyle and medical reasons. To fight fatigue, it is essential to get enough sleep and eat healthy and exercise regularly. It is also important to manage stress.

Sometimes, people with health conditions that are underlying, such as heart disease or diabetes might suffer from unrelenting fatigue. Your doctor will look into your symptoms and conduct tests to find out the cause of your fatigue.

Your doctor will examine your blood pressure and inquire about your lifestyle like how much sleep you get and if you consume alcohol or take medications regularly. If a diagnosis is made the doctor will prescribe medications or make changes to your lifestyle to help you feel better.

A visit to your doctor regarding your symptoms and looking at your health is the most effective way of dealing with these symptoms. Your doctor will examine your weight, your blood pressure, your cholesterol levels and may want to conduct some tests to rule out other health issues that may cause your fatigue.

Many health issues can lead to chronic fatigue, including anemia, heart diseases, thyroid disorders, cancer and chronic fatigue syndrome. These symptoms can be a sign of an underlying medical condition that is serious and should not be overlooked.

Depression

Depression is a serious mental illness that can affect a person's everyday life. It can cause feelings of despair, sadness or emptiness that can last for a long period of time.

Often, depression develops in response to traumatizing or difficult events in the life of a person. This could include the loss of a loved one, divorce, job loss, illness, or other challenges.

Other triggers for depression are stress, family history as well as alcohol and drug use.
